**Q: Why does TilePorter prefetch tiles two zoom levels ahead instead of one?**

A: Field testing on the Marrowick transit app showed that users pinch-zoom in bursts, so a one-level lookahead still caused blank tiles on mid-range devices. Two levels keeps the cache hit rate above 95% while staying under the 40 MB budget enforced by the Quarrystone cache layer. If you believe a change to this heuristic is warranted, open a review against the prefetch-policy module and flag it for the TilePorter maintainers at the address below.

escalation mailbox, bafog-fafog: ulador@paliqlabs.internal

Subject: Hiring Freeze — Corvale Instruments Division

Dear Board Members,

Following careful review of first-half performance, the executive team has approved an immediate hiring freeze within the Corvale Instruments division. Open requisitions are paused pending the autumn forecast; critical safety roles may proceed by exception. We expect savings of roughly four percent of divisional payroll. The connected plan is set out below.

management briefing: Istaelix Group is in early talks to buy Sorysax Logistics for about $496.2 million. The Kasox launch date is October 3, and nothing goes to the press before then. Legal wants the Norokax Foods term sheet withdrawn before April 25.

# sqlsentry lint config — Brindlewood data platform.
# These vars control which rule packs load for .sql files in CI.
# Keep RULESET=strict on main; feature branches may use relaxed.
# Dialect detection is automatic; override only for legacy Marrow
# warehouse scripts. Violations block merge, no exceptions.
# The lint service fetches shared rule packs from our registry,
# which requires an access token. It belongs on the following line.

env line for fafof-fahag: LEDGER_TOKEN5=f8790

**Ticket: Expired token blocking render-perf benchmarks**

For the release manager: the nightly template-rendering benchmark suite on Quenchmark has been silent for four days. Root cause is an expired credential for the internal metrics collector, not a performance regression. Benchmarks themselves still pass locally; we simply lost reporting. A replacement credential has been issued and validated against staging. To unblock the release gate, the new key for the collector service is provided below.

API key for tagef-fafop: vxb2-ta